About Breton Court
Breton Court is a residential care home in Tenterden, in the Kent council area, registered with the Care Quality Commission for up to 28 residents. It provides care for older people. It is run by A Better Carehome. The home has been registered since January 2012.
At its latest inspection, published March 2023, the CQC rated Breton Court Good, which means the CQC found the service performing well and meeting its expectations. Ratings can change after a new inspection, so check the CQC report before you visit.
Breton Court has not published its fees and has not yet confirmed them to us. Care homes in Kent with a fee on record typically charge about £1,500 a week for residential care and £1,550 for nursing care, so expect a figure in that range and ask the home for a written quote.

Does Breton Court provide nursing care?
No. Breton Court is registered as a care home without nursing. Staff provide personal care; visiting district nurses cover nursing needs.
